Distribution of delta~(34S) and delta~(18)O in SO~(2-)_4 in Groundwater from the Ordos Cretaceous Groundwater Basin and Geological Implications

英文摘要The Ordos Cretaceous Groundwater Basin,located in an arid-semiarid area in northwestern China,is a large-style groundwater basin.SO~(2-)_4 is one of the major harmful components ingroundwater.Dissolved SO~(2-)_4 concentrations,and delta~(34)S-SO~(2-)_4 and delta~(18)SO-SO~(2-)_4 in groundwater from 14 boreholes and in gypsum from aquifer were analyzed.Results show that SO~(2-)_4 in shallow groundwaters originates from precipitation,sulfide oxidation,and dissolution of stratum sulphate,with a big range of delta~(34)S values,from-10.7 to 9.2,and addition of SO~(2-)_4 in deep groundwater results from dissolution of stratum sulphate,with bigger delta~(34)S values,from 7.8 to 18.5,compared with those in shallow groundwater.This research also indicates that three types of sulphate are present in the strata,and characterized by high delta~(34)S values and high delta~(18)SO values-style,high delta~(34)S values and middle delta~(18)O values-style,middle delta~(34)S values and low delta~(18)O values-style,respectively.The delta~(34)S-SO~(2-)_4 and delta~(18)O-SO~(2-)_4 in groundwater have a good perspective for application in distinguishing different groundwater systems and determining groundwater circulation and evolution in this area.
